Projected Growth of the IoT-based Asset Tracking and Monitoring Market
The IoT-based Asset Tracking and Monitoring Market is anticipated to reach a valuation of USD 5.7 billion by 2025, with expectations to grow to USD 18.5 billion by 2035, reflecting a compound annual growth rate (CAGR) of 12.5% during this period. This growth underscores the increasing implementation of IoT solutions across various industries such as logistics, manufacturing, healthcare, and energy, where the need for real-time visibility and predictive analytics is crucial. The market is set to nearly triple in size by 2035, driven by escalating investments in IoT sensors, cloud technology, and AI-driven analytics. It is projected that by 2030, the market value will exceed USD 10 billion, fueled by advancements in supply chain optimization and regulatory compliance. Sustained long-term growth will be supported by ongoing digital transformation efforts, the rise of connected devices, and an increasing demand for operational efficiency.

Analysis of the Wi-Fi Connectivity Segment
The Wi-Fi segment is expected to account for 41.60% of the market’s total revenue by 2025, establishing itself as the leading connectivity option. This dominance is due to its extensive infrastructure, affordability, and capacity for high data transfer rates. Wi-Fi facilitates seamless integration with existing enterprise networks and ensures ongoing asset visibility in indoor settings like warehouses, factories, and distribution centers. Its compatibility with both mobile and stationary assets, coupled with advancements in newer standards that reduce latency and enhance energy efficiency, strengthens its role in asset tracking initiatives. As businesses continue to focus on network reliability and centralized data management, the use of Wi-Fi for IoT-based asset tracking is expected to grow, solidifying its prominent position within this sector.
Insights into Livestock Monitoring Applications
The livestock monitoring application segment is projected to capture 38.90% of total revenue by 2025, establishing itself as the primary use case. This growth is driven by the increasing global demand for precision livestock farming, which aims to enhance animal health, traceability, and resource management. IoT-based monitoring solutions facilitate continuous observation of animal movements, behaviors, and vital signs, enabling early illness detection and optimized breeding strategies. The use of GPS collars, biometric sensors, and centralized monitoring systems has simplified farm management and minimized economic losses. The rising emphasis on food safety, livestock welfare, and sustainable farming practices is further propelling the uptake of these technologies. Consequently, livestock monitoring stands out as a key application of IoT-based asset tracking, significantly impacting productivity and cost management.

Market Analysis by Key Countries
The IoT-based asset tracking and monitoring market is forecasted to grow at a CAGR of 12.5% from 2025 to 2035, spurred by the rising adoption of smart logistics, industrial automation, and predictive maintenance solutions. China is projected to lead with a 16.9% CAGR, driven by extensive IoT deployment in manufacturing and transportation. India follows closely at 15.6%, bolstered by increasing adoption in supply chain management and smart warehousing. Germany is expected to grow at 14.4%, benefiting from advanced industrial automation and IoT integration in manufacturing. The UK, with an 11.9% CAGR, is focusing on intelligent logistics and connected infrastructure, while the USA anticipates a 10.6% growth rate from fleet management and enterprise asset monitoring applications. Competitive Landscape of the IoT-based Asset Tracking and Monitoring Market
Quectel Wireless Solutions Co., Ltd. offers robust IoT modules and communication solutions that enable real-time asset tracking across logistics, transportation, and industrial sectors. u-blox AG specializes in secure positioning and wireless connectivity solutions, ensuring reliable monitoring and seamless integration with cloud platforms. Fibocom Wireless Inc. provides cellular IoT modules that are optimized for low power consumption and high data efficiency, catering to a wide variety of tracking applications. Telit Cinterion Group enhances asset visibility through scalable IoT modules and connectivity platforms, emphasizing global deployment and interoperability. Semtech Corporation focuses on LoRa-based networking technology, providing long-range, low-power tracking for distributed assets. Samsara Inc. combines sensor hardware with advanced analytics to deliver actionable insights for fleet management, supply chain optimization, and equipment monitoring. Nordic Semiconductor ASA offers ultra-low-power wireless solutions for compact and battery-sensitive tracking devices, ensuring extended operational life. Collectively, these companies are fostering the adoption of IoT-enabled asset tracking by enhancing efficiency, operational control, and data-driven decision-making across industries.
